Tea, Coffee and Company - a cheeky request?

An important strand of Neurosupport’s work, NeuroLife, is coming to an end because, quite simply, funding has come to an end.  NeuroLife provided arts courses, lifestyle courses and,  most importantly, brought people with neurological conditions together to share experiences and rebuild confidence and, yes, have some fun!  We’re all very sad that NeuroLife is finishing but we’re trying to keep some of it’s spirit alive by continuing an important and enjoyable part of it alive…

Tea, Coffee and Company - like it says on the tin - aims to bring people with neurological conditions together to share experiences, have a chat and make friendships - all over a cuppa and maybe a biscuit or two.  It’s been a great success and has helped no end in helping the confidence of so many people with neurological conditions.

Tea, Coffee and Company takes place on the first Monday morning of each month and Neurosupport is looking for sponsors and donations to help keep it going.

Neurosupport is a charity offering non-medical support and advice to people with neurological conditions, their families and carers.  Neurosupport is based in the centre of Liverpool, United Kingdom.
